Hotels in Hjellestad

Discover best hotels in Hjellestad within seconds

Popular hotels in Hjellestad

Villa Charlotte
Villa Charlotte

Hotels in Hjellestad on the Map

All hotels in Hjellestad

Villa Charlotte
Villa Charlotte